当前位置: 首页 > article >正文

在本地部署DSR1模型的技术方案和步骤指南

在本地部署DSR1模型,支持10人同时使用,具备团队知识库和个人知识库功能,同时能够连接网页、邮箱、Slack等聊天工具,类似于AI Agent。
要在本地部署支持上述功能的DSR1模型,涉及到多个复杂步骤,以下是一个大致的技术方案和步骤指南:

1. 环境准备

  1. 硬件环境
    • 确保服务器具备足够的计算资源,以支持10人同时使用。推荐使用多核CPU(如Intel Xeon系列)、大容量内存(32GB或更高)以及足够的存储(根据知识库大小而定)。
    • 如果DSR1模型支持GPU加速,配备NVIDIA GPU及相应的CUDA驱动。
  2. 软件环境
    • 操作系统:推荐使用Linux系统,如Ubuntu 20.04 LTS。
    • 编程语言和依赖:根据DSR1模型的开发语言,安装相应的编程语言环境(如Python 3.8+),以及相关的依赖库,如深度学习框架(如PyTorch)。
    • 数据库:选择适合的数据库来存储团队知识库和个人知识库,如PostgreSQL或MySQL。安装并配置好数据库服务。

2. 部署DSR1模型

  1. 获取模型:从官方渠道或模型托管平台获取DSR1模型的权重文件和相关代码。
  2. 模型部署
    • 将模型代码放置在服务器的合适目录下。
    • 根据模型的运行要求,配置模型参数,如输入输出格式、模型路径等。
    • 启动模型服务,可以使用如Flask或FastAPI等Web框架将模型封装为API服务,以便通过网络进行访问。示例代码(以Flask为例):
from flask import Flask, request, jsonify
import torch
# 假设模型相关代码和类已导入
app = Flask(__name__)

@app.route('/predict', methods=['POST'])
def predict():
    data = request.get_json(force=True)
    # 处理输入数据,进行模型预测
  

http://www.kler.cn/a/527535.html

相关文章:

  • PCA9685 一款由 NXP Semiconductors 生产的 16 通道、12 位 PWM(脉宽调制)控制器芯片
  • 基于 yolov8_pyqt5 自适应界面设计的火灾检测系统 demo:毕业设计参考
  • Keepalived高可用集群企业应用实例一
  • 字符串p型编码(信息奥赛一本通1145)
  • 数据结构:栈篇
  • 【算法】分治
  • 常用Android模拟器(雷电 MuMu 夜神 Genymotion 蓝叠) - 20250131
  • 基于LLM的垂直领域问答方案
  • 深入理解 C# 与.NET 框架
  • windows电脑运行日志用户行为记录查看和清理工具
  • 【字符串两大注意事项】
  • CF EDU ROUND 171
  • Memcached add 命令详解
  • 计算机网络之计算机网络的分类
  • 对有向无环图进行拓扑排序
  • FFmpeg在Ubuntu18.04上的安装
  • 本地化部署DeepSeek-R1
  • jdk8项目升级到jdk17——岁月云实战
  • 从0开始使用面对对象C语言搭建一个基于OLED的图形显示框架(基础组件实现)
  • 51单片机开发——I2C通信接口